To: The Right Honourable Prime Minister of Canada:

WHEREAS, a report from the House of Commons Finance Committee has recommended that the government strip churches, Christian charities, and pro-life organizations of their charitable status, crippling them financially, and 

WHEREAS, these radical proposals would impose a 100% revocation tax, allowing the government to seize the assets of religious organizations, shutting down churches, food banks, and faith-based charities across Canada, and 

WHEREAS, freedom of religion and freedom of speech are fundamental rights enshrined in the Canadian Charter of Rights and Freedoms and must be protected from government overreach. 

TH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ED THAT, the undersigned does hereby immediately and unequivocally demand that the above proposals be officially retracted and reject any attempt to strip churches, Christian charities, and pro-life organizations of their legal standing or charitable status while defending their right to exist without government interference, financial penalties, or forced closure.
